There five types of surge arrester: 1. Rod gap arrester 2. Horn gap arrester 3. Protector tube or expulsion type 4. Thyrite lighting arrester 5. Gapless arrester or metal oxide arrester

The MCOV (Maximum Continuous Operating Voltage) rating for a lightning arrester is the maximum voltage that the arrester can continuously withstand without failing. It is important to select a lightning arrester with an appropriate MCOV rating to ensure that it can effectively protect against overvoltage events without being damaged.

Long flashover arresters typically use a combination of materials, including silicon carbide (SiC) or zinc oxide (ZnO), which provide high resistance to electrical breakdown while ensuring efficient voltage clamping. These materials are chosen for their ability to withstand high voltages and environmental conditions, as well as their durability and performance in protecting electrical systems. Additionally, insulating materials like porcelain or polymer composites may be used in conjunction with these semiconductor materials to enhance their effectiveness and reliability.
